Labor by Type Report
Analyze labor hours categorized by pay type to understand labor distribution and costs.
Accessing the Report
Reports > Production > Labor by Type
or
From an estimate: Estimate > Reports > Labor by Type
Key Metrics
| Metric | Description |
|---|---|
| Pay Type | Category of labor (Carpentry, Demo, etc.) |
| Hours | Total hours worked |
| Rate | Labor rate per hour |
| Cost | Hours × Rate |
| By Project | Breakdown per project |

Calculations
Labor Cost
Labor Cost = Hours × Hourly Rate
Burden (if configured)
Burdened Cost = Labor Cost × (1 + Burden %)
Burden includes:
- Payroll taxes
- Benefits
- Workers comp
- Insurance
Analysis Use Cases
Estimating Accuracy
Compare actual vs. estimated:
- Are certain types consistently over?
- Which types are most variable?
- Adjust future estimates accordingly
Labor Mix
Analyze how labor is distributed:
- % skilled vs. general labor
- Travel time as % of total
- PM time vs. field time
Project Comparison
Compare similar projects:
- Which used more of certain types?
- What drove the differences?
- Lessons for future projects
